Domanda.

nome=Paola
cognome=Miccoli
versione=2000
conosco2=medio
email=paolamiccoli@tiscali.it
chr=685
problema=Mi scuso per la banalità della mia domanda.
Mi riferisco al database "MultiDB2-2000": come posso convertire il formato delle celle in modo tale che
posso avere dei "numeri interi" invece che "testo"? Ho provato ma utilizzando l'inserimento tramite form il num di  telefono me lo accetta solo formato testo!!
Aiuto
 

Risposta.

ciao Paola, il problema è presto spiegato : Excel NON accetta numeri interi che comincino per zero. Ora, poichè, a parte i cellulari, tutti i numeri di telefono iniziano con lo zero ( 0 ), è necessario impostare il formato delle celle che ospiteranno il telefono a "Testo". In questo modo excel accetta un valore che considera testo, e come tale puoi scrivere ciò che vuoi. Sul database che hai scaricato, il formato celle del campo telefono è impostato a Testo, per questo non accetta numeri. Se invece vuoi che un valore sia riconosciuto da excel come valore numerico quando dalla textbox passa al foglio, devi usare il formato di conversione del tipo di dati (vedi vba, sull'altro sito ), per cui esemplificando:
Range("pincopallino") = CDbl(textbox1)
e ciò che scrivi nella textbox sarà passato come valore Double, cioè con decimali. oppure:
Range("pincopallino") = CInt(textbox1) e sarà passato come valore Integer
cioè intero, ecc. ecc.
un saluto, ennius